§ 163.247 PERFORMANCE STANDARDS.
   (A)   The development shall be consistent with the Comprehensive Plan.
   (B)   All of the properties in the C-PUD shall be under the same ownership at the time of application. All properties within the C-PUD must be scheduled to be developed under the same ownership.
   (C)   The development plan must include provisions for the preservation of natural amenities.
   (D)   The C-PUD proposal must be in harmony with existing developments in the area surrounding the project site.
   (E)   The C-PUD must be comprised of at least ten acres of contiguous land.
   (F)   There must be a minimum of 20% of the gross land area within the C-PUD that is preserved for private or public open air recreational use. The open space calculation shall not include land used for streets, parking or private yards. The Planning Commission may specify which areas should be preserved or that are integral. The areas to be preserved must be protected by covenants running with the land or by conveyances or dedication.
   (G)   Spacing between main buildings and dedicated streets shall be at least equivalent to the spacing requirements of buildings similarly developed under the terms of this subchapter on separate parcels.
   (H)   Subdivision review under the subdivision regulations shall be carried out simultaneously with the review of the C-PUD under this subchapter.
